Christian, Wolfgang; Belloni, Mario; Sokolowska, Dagmara; Cox, Anne; Dancy, Melissa – Physics Education, 2020
Over the past 25 years, the Davidson College Physics Department has developed small computer programs called Physlets. These programs were written in Java and distributed as Java applets embedded in HTML pages.
